EU Parliament: dialogue with Russian democratic forces. Metsola: “Immediate and unconditional release of all political prisoners”

(Brussels) Just a few days after the reopening of an institutional communication channel between the European Union and Russia – confirmed by the President of the European Council, Antonio Costa, during the latest EU-27 Summit –, the European Parliament is hosting the second edition of the “Brussels Dialogue”. The high-level summit brought together representatives of EU institutions and Russian democratic forces, anti-war activists and civil society representatives. Opening the discussions, President Roberta Metsola recalled the European Parliament’s commitment to supporting “Russian citizens jailed simply for demanding democratic freedoms” and its relentless call for “the immediate and unconditional release of all political prisoners who remain unjustly imprisoned”. Referring to Andrey Sakharov, Anna Politkovskaya and Alexei Navalny, Vice-President Pina Picierno pointed out in her speech that “democratic ideas often survive because of people who refuse to give in to fear and lies”. The stated aim is to strengthen coordination between national authorities and European institutions to ensure the protection of those at risk by creating a “European list of people exposed to risks due to their commitment to freedom, human rights and democracy”.
